Tree Regulations and Permits

Do I need a permit?

  • In Turlock, many removals or significant pruning of protected trees require a permit under the City’s Tree Preservation Ordinance. Street trees and certain heritage or landmark trees may be protected even on private property.
  • If you’re unsure, treat removal or heavy pruning as needing a permit until you confirm with city staff. Removing a protected tree without authorization can trigger penalties and a requirement to replace the tree.
  • Distinguish between street trees, trees in utility easements, and private trees—the rules can differ by location and species.

How to determine protected status

  • Check the City of Turlock Planning Department’s guidance on tree protection and the local ordinances governing trees.
  • Contact the Planning Division for a formal determination if you’re unsure whether your tree is protected.
  • A qualified arborist can provide a professional assessment that supports your permit request and helps you understand maintenance limits.

How to apply for a permit

1. Gather essentials: property address, tree species, approximate DBH (diameter at breast height), photos of the tree and the surrounding area, and a clear work description.

2. Submit the permit application through the City’s online portal or Planning counter.

3. Include any required plans or assessments that the city requests (e.g., tree impact or site plans).

4. Pay any applicable fees and await review.

5. Be prepared for an on-site inspection or an arborist report if the city requires it, and respond to any city requests promptly.

Exemptions and routine maintenance

  • Routine pruning that complies with standard maintenance practices and does not remove protected trees may be exempt in some cases, but this varies by code. Verify before performing cuts beyond mild shaping or deadwood removal, especially during nesting seasons.
  • If a tree is dead or deemed structurally hazardous, you may still need to notify the city and/or obtain guidance on safe removal or necessary remediation.

Timeline and inspections

  • Review times vary with workload and whether additional reviews or hearings are needed; expect several weeks in typical cases.
  • Work is usually prohibited until a permit is issued. Inspections occur before work starts, during critical phases, and after completion to confirm compliance.

Almond (Prunus dulcis)

  • Local prevalence and challenges: Common in nearby orchard blocks; landscape almond trees in residential yards are less frequent but possible. Expect heavy fruiting wood, brittle branches after heavy crops, and borers in stressed trees. Sudden drought stress or root-zone salinity can weaken trees and invite diseases.
  • Pruning and care: Prune to maintain a balanced scaffold, start pruning lightly in late winter/early spring after leaf-out, and avoid heavy pruning during bloom. Water deeply but infrequently to encourage deep roots; mulching helps with moisture retention.
  • Removal considerations: If removing an orchard-standard tree, consider soil testing and replant timing. No special permit typically required for a private backyard tree, but check for orchard-specific regulations if you’re in farming zones.

Walnut (Juglans regia)

  • Local prevalence and challenges: Walnuts are common in Stanislaus County; in yards they can be stunning but demand ample space. Watch for infestations by codling moth and aphids, as well as potential root diseases in poorly drained soils.
  • Pruning and care: Schedule pruning for late winter to early spring before bud break; avoid heavy pruning in hot weather. Provide deep, consistent irrigation and well-drained soil to prevent root rot.
  • Removal considerations: Large walnut trees can be protected by county or city ordinances if near infrastructure. If removal is contemplated, confirm with local authorities and plan for proper disposal of wood waste.

Pistachio (Pistacia vera)

Pistachio (Pistacia vera) in the summer
  • Local prevalence and challenges: Pistachios are a steady part of the region’s broader crop pattern. In yards, they can tolerate heat but require well-drained soil and steady irrigation. Salinity and borers are typical concerns under drought conditions.
  • Pruning and care: Light, structural pruning to maintain form; avoid removing functional scaffolds. Water management is key—keep root zones moist but not waterlogged; monitor soil salinity.
  • Removal considerations: Usually not protected, but check with local agricultural offices if part of a larger block or protected landscape area.

Chinese Pistache (Pistacia chinensis)

Chinese Pistache (Pistacia chinensis) in the summer
  • Local prevalence and challenges: A popular landscape selection for heat tolerance and striking fall color. Drought tolerance is good, but young trees need regular moisture as roots establish. Pests are less aggressive than in some oaks or fruit trees.
  • Pruning and care: Prune for a strong central leader or well-spaced branching structure. Avoid heavy pruning during extreme heat; best in late winter or early spring. Mulch and water at the tree base.
  • Removal considerations: Generally unregulated as a landscape tree; verify with local authorities if the tree sits near utilities or in a protected area.

Valley Oak (Quercus lobata)

Valley Oak (Quercus lobata) in the summer
  • Local prevalence and challenges: Native oak with iconic form, but root systems can be extensive and sturdy. In Turlock’s urban settings, we see valley oaks growing away from foundations; removal or significant pruning may require permits, as oaks are sensitive to habitat protections.
  • Pruning and care: Prune during late winter to reduce oak wilt risk and to shape without stressing the tree. Avoid topping; focus on balanced crown reduction only as needed.
  • Removal considerations: Oak protection ordinances exist in some jurisdictions. Always check with City of Turlock or Stanislaus County before removing or severely pruning an oak to ensure compliance with local oak protection guidelines and disease-control practices.

Peach (Prunus persica)

  • Local prevalence and challenges: Common in home orchards and utility-friendly landscapes. Susceptible to peach leaf curl, borers, and heat/water stress. Fruit splitting can occur after heavy spring rains.
  • Pruning and care: Prune to maintain an open center or low-branching framework; remove crossing or inward-growing limbs. Water consistently, especially during fruit set; mulch to conserve moisture.
  • Removal considerations: orchard trees are typically not protected, but coordinate with local ag/extension offices if your yard sits in shoreland or protected zones.

Modesto Ash (Fraxinus velutina)

  • Local prevalence and challenges: Historically used as street trees in the Central Valley; vulnerable to pests such as ash borers and drought stress. In periods of heat and water restrictions, these trees can decline rapidly.
  • Pruning and care: Prune during late winter when dormant, avoiding late-spring pruning in hot months. Maintain even moisture and monitor for signs of borers or girdling roots.
  • Removal considerations: Fraxinus species face pest pressures; if instability or heavy decline is evident, removal or major crown reduction may be warranted. Check for local ordinances or permit requirements if the tree is near utilities or in a protected zone.

Crape Myrtle (Lagerstroemia indica)

Crape Myrtle (Lagerstroemia indica) in the summer
  • Local prevalence and challenges: Very popular in Turlock landscapes for color and drought tolerance. Heat and alkaline soils can cause occasional bark cracks or powdery mildew in humid microclimates.
  • Pruning and care: Prune in late winter to shape and encourage flowering; do not remove all flowering wood. Irrigate deeply during dry summers; ensure good drainage to prevent root rot.
  • Removal considerations: Generally not protected; coordinate with a local arborist if removing due to storm or structural issues.

London Plane (Platanus x acerifolia)

London Plane (Platanus x acerifolia) in the summer
  • Local prevalence and challenges: A staple for street canopies and large yards in Turlock; tolerant of urban heat, but brittle branches can pose hazards after storms or high winds. Surface roots may damage sidewalks.
  • Pruning and care: Prune in late winter to early spring for structure; remove deadwood responsibly. Provide regular irrigation and mulching; avoid girdling roots by proper planting depth.
  • Removal considerations: If the tree is large near utilities or sidewalks, ensure you secure necessary permits and plan for professional removal or large-diameter pruning.

California Sycamore (Platanus racemosa)

California Sycamore (Platanus racemosa) in the summer
  • Local prevalence and challenges: Native to California, occasionally used in larger landscapes. Can be susceptible to anthracnose in coastal microclimates and may shed limbs in drought stress.
  • Pruning and care: Remove deadwood, thin for airflow, and prune during dormancy. Keep well-watered during establishment and drought periods.
  • Removal considerations: As a native oak-relative tree, check for local protection rules before removal; consult the city or county for permit requirements.

Cottonwood (Populus fremontii)

Cottonwood (Populus fremontii) in the summer
  • Local prevalence and challenges: Fast-growing and large, often used near irrigation channels or open spaces. Shallow roots and brittle branches can complicate maintenance; windthrow risk during storms is real.
  • Pruning and care: Structural pruning to remove weak branches; manage water availability to curb root spread and reduce storm damage risk.
  • Removal considerations: Removal may require oversight if the tree is near utilities or on protected land; verify with local authorities.

Olive (Olea europaea)

Olive (Olea europaea) in the summer
  • Local prevalence and challenges: Dry-land adaptability makes olive a common Mediterranean-styled accent tree. Susceptible to olive psyllid and leaf spot in wet springs; drought-tolerant once established.
  • Pruning and care: Maintain an open canopy to maximize light, prune in late winter to early spring; avoid over-watering. Fertilize lightly in early spring if needed.
  • Removal considerations: Generally not protected; ensure proper disposal of pruning residues to prevent pest spread.

Date Palm (Phoenix canariensis)

Date Palm (Phoenix canariensis) in the summer
  • Local prevalence and challenges: Decorative, heat-tolerant feature in many yards. Prickly old fronds and heavy fruit stalks can pose cleanup hazards; drought stress is mitigated with regular irrigation.
  • Pruning and care: Remove dead fronds safely, cleanly, and minimally. Provide deep, infrequent irrigation rather than frequent shallow watering.
  • Removal considerations: Not typically protected; check with a licensed arborist if the trunk or crown is compromised by disease or storm damage.

Signs Your Tree Needs Attention in Turlock

In Turlock, the mix of heavy clay soils, wet winters, hot dry summers, and urban landscapes creates distinctive stresses for residential trees. Winter rains can saturate the root zone and loosen the soil around the root collar, while summer heat and irrigation demand push trees to cope with drought conditions. A gusty storm can topple or crack a tree that’s already under soil- or canopy-related stress. Recognizing local cues—sudden dieback, trunk cracks, base mushrooms, or exposed roots—lets you intervene before a failure happens.

This section uses local patterns to help you spot problems early: general red flags that apply to any tree, species-specific symptoms common in Turlock’s plantings, storm and wind damage risks here, and pest and disease signs we frequently see in Central Valley landscapes. Keep a photo log, note changes after big rains or heat waves, and when in doubt, schedule an arborist evaluation.

General Red Flags for Any Tree

  • Dead or dying branches, especially in the upper crown or interior of the tree.
  • Leaning trunk or a trunk with cracks, splits, or newly exposed roots at the root collar.
  • Wounds with peeling or gapping bark, deep cavities, or oozing sap.
  • Fungal growth or fruiting bodies on the trunk, branches, or at the base (mushrooms, conks).
  • Roots visibly exposed, lifted soil around the root zone, or wisdom of girdling roots near the trunk.
  • Sudden canopy thinning, sparse foliage, or leaf scorch in mid-season.
  • Joint failures in limb unions (included bark) or deadwood that creates weak attachments.
  • Cracked soil around the root flare, heaves near sidewalks, or repeated heaving after rains.
  • Soft, crumbly wood, hollow areas, or audible cracking when branches are stressed.
  • Pests or signs of pests (sticky residue, frass piles, or unusual boreholes) visible on bark or wood.

Assessment steps you can take now:

1) From the ground, inspect the crown for dead limbs and signs of distress. 2) Look up for cracks, splits, or loose bark at the trunk and major branches. 3) Check around the base for exposed roots, soil movement, or girdling roots. 4) Note any unusual odors, oozing sap, or mushrooms at the base. 5) If more than one red flag appears, plan an arborist assessment.

Pest and Disease Signs to Watch For Locally

  • Bark beetles and wood borers (common in drought- and heat-stressed trees): small exit holes in bark, fine sawdust (frass), galleries under bark, or sudden bark thinning.
  • Scale insects and other sap-suckers: sticky honeydew, curled or distorted leaves, and white or gray crusty coverings on stems.
  • Aphids and related pests: curled, distorted leaves and honeydew that can foster sooty mold.
  • Fungal infections and cankers: oozing sap or dark, sunken areas on the trunk or branches; mushrooms or conks at base or on the trunk.
  • Root rot indicators: soft, discolored roots; a foul smell at the base; mushrooms or fungal growth at the soil line; trees that feel weak and wobbly when touched.
  • Oak disease signs (notably in our oak species in the Central Valley): leaf spot or scorch, strong crown decline, and presence of cankers or oozing sap on the trunk; look to UC IPM resources for confirmation and management steps.
  • Management notes:
  • Local stress compounds pest pressures, so maintaining consistent watering, mulching, and proper pruning can reduce susceptibility.
  • Use UC IPM’s pest notes and pest management guidance for CA trees to identify species-specific treatments and avoid broad-spectrum approaches.
  • If you observe multiple pests or disease signs, schedule an inspection with an ISA-certified arborist to prevent misdiagnosis and improper management.

Best Time of Year for Tree Work in Turlock

Turlock sits in the Central Valley, where winters are cool and damp and summers are blisteringly hot and dry. Most rainfall arrives from November through February, with soil often wet after storms but drying quickly in spring. Frost is occasional but can hit during cold snaps, and January through February can bring Tule fog and gusty winter winds. This pattern means timing your trimming, pruning, or removal around dormancy, moisture, and heat helps trees recover faster and reduces disease risk. Planning around wet winters and hot summers also protects soil structure and minimizes stress on trees during peak heat and drought periods.

  • Dormant periods (late fall through winter) are usually the best window for structural pruning and major removals.
  • Growing-season pruning (late winter to early spring) is useful for light shaping or flowering-trelated timing, but timing matters for sap flow and bloom.
  • Book early for peak seasons, since local crews get busy around winter dormancy and spring flowering windows.
  • Watch sap flow in maples and other species with prominent bleeding; if sap is rising, delay heavy cuts until dormancy or after a brief pause in growth.
  • After pruning or removal, provide adequate post-work irrigation if soils are dry, especially through dry springs and heat waves.

General Guidelines for Most Trees

  • Favor dormant-season work when the tree is leafless, typically Nov–Feb, to reduce disease exposure and improve wound closure.
  • Avoid heavy pruning during wet winter storms to limit pathogen spread and soil compaction.
  • For species prone to sap bleeding (e.g., maples), plan pruning when sap flow is minimal and avoid large cuts during rising sap.
  • Do not perform major removals during extreme heat; wait for cooler days to reduce plant stress.
  • Always use a licensed arborist for major cuts, hazardous removals, or work near power lines; DIY risks increase when soils are saturated or winds are strong.

Optimal Seasons for Pruning Common Local Species

  • Maples, elms, and oaks: best in late winter while dormant; light shaping can occur after leaf-out, but avoid heavy cuts during active growth.
  • Flowering trees that bloom in spring (crabapple, cherry, plum): prune after flowering ends to protect next year’s blooms.
  • Crape myrtle: prune in late winter to promote strong structure and colorful bark; avoid heavy pruning in summer heat.
  • Fruit trees (peach, plum, apple): prune in late winter before bud break; thin and shape carefully to reduce pest entry points.
  • Evergreens (pine, fir, juniper): prune lightly in late winter or after new growth in summer, avoiding heavy cuts that stress trees during drought.

When to Schedule Tree Removal

  • Non-emergency removals: target late fall to winter when trees are dormant and soils are cooler, making access easier and cleanup more straightforward.
  • In dry stretches: plan during the dry season when soil is workable and moisture is sufficient to avoid compaction but not waterlogged.
  • For hazardous removals or dead/dying trees: schedule promptly with an arborist, prioritizing safety and storm-season planning.

Seasons to Avoid and Why

  • Avoid heavy pruning in late summer and early fall; new growth may be vulnerable to heat, drought, and sun damage before the first frost.
  • Avoid pruning during the wettest part of winter to minimize disease spread and soil saturation.
  • Bloom timing matters: prune spring-blooming trees after they finish flowering to preserve next year’s blossoms.
  • Be mindful of root-zone stress during drought; follow watering guidance after pruning to prevent sunscald and root injury.

Average Costs for Tree Services in Turlock

Costs in Turlock are driven by local labor rates, equipment access on larger lots with mature evergreen specimens versus dense, closely spaced suburban blocks, and disposal fees at nearby landfills. Seasonal demand, permit or regulatory requirements, and the presence of tall conifers that require specialized gear all push pricing up in certain windows. In addition, properties with long driveways, steep or uneven terrain, or waterfront-canopy views (where care must be taken to preserve sightlines) tend to add a bit of extra time and risk to jobs.

Prices you’ll see in 2025–2026 reflect current fuel costs, insurance, and disposal charges in Stanislaus County. They are averages and can vary widely by company, exact site conditions, and scope of work. Use these ranges as benchmarks when you’re comparing bids for your Turlock home, not as guarantees of the final number.

Typical Cost Ranges for Tree Trimming and Pruning

  • Small trees and light pruning (up to ~20 ft): $150–$350
  • Medium trees (20–40 ft): $300–$800
  • Large trees (40–60 ft): $800–$1,600
  • Very large or specialty pruning (60+ ft, tall conifers, multi-trunk specimens): $1,600–$3,000+

Notes:

  • Prices assume clean access and standard cleanup. If crews must work around structures, power lines, or along narrow driveways, expect higher bids.
  • In Turlock, summer heat and post-storm cleanup can push costs upward due to longer workdays and equipment wear.

Tree Removal Costs by Size and Complexity

  • Small tree removal (roughly 3–6" DBH, easy access): $200–$500
  • Medium removal (6–12" DBH, moderate access): $500–$1,500
  • Large removal (12–24" DBH, restricted access or near structures): $1,500–$3,000
  • Extra-large or highly complex removals (24"+ DBH, close to buildings, in tight lots): $3,000–$7,000+

Factors that raise price:

  • Access challenges (long driveways, tight corners, gated properties)
  • Proximity to structures, fences, or utilities
  • Storm damage or emergency work, which often triggers higher rates

Stump Grinding and Removal

  • Stump grinding (per stump): $100–$300 for small stumps; larger stumps scale up
  • Per-inch pricing (typical range): $2–$7 per inch of diameter
  • Full stump removal (grind plus root-removal and cleanup): $200–$500+ per stump, depending on size and access

Tips:

  • If you plan to replant or reseed, confirm whether the bid includes removing the stump entirely or just grinding the top.

Additional Fees and Add-Ons

  • Debris removal and haul-away: often included in higher-tier quotes; sometimes charged separately ($60–$150 per load)
  • Wood chipping, mulching, or hauling firewood off-site: may be extra
  • Permits or regulatory fees: $100–$400 depending on jurisdiction and required approvals
  • Emergency/storm rates: commonly 1.5×–2× the standard rate for after-hours or urgent work
  • Insurance and license verification: ensure bids reflect proper coverage; cheaper bids without proof of license or insurance are a red flag

Important: disposal costs at local facilities can vary. In Turlock, many crews factor in landfill or recycling charges, which can influence total price, especially for large-volume jobs.

Aftercare and Long-Term Tree Maintenance in Turlock

Proper aftercare matters in Turlock because our climate swings between hot, dry summers and cooler, wetter winters, and soils range from heavy clay to sandy loam. Pruning wounds in wet winter months heal faster when rain moisture can support callus formation, while long, droughty summers stress newly trimmed trees. In shaded lots under tall evergreens, on sloped suburban yards, or near irrigation lines, microclimates drive moisture availability and heat exposure—so treatment and monitoring must adapt to local conditions. Even modest soil compression or elevated irrigation salts from municipal water can influence recovery, so a thoughtful, site-specific approach pays off.

Immediate Post-Trimming or Removal Care

  • Do not apply wound dressings or paint/stain over pruning cuts. Most modern guides advise against routine wound dressing as it can trap moisture and delay healing.
  • Remove all pruning debris and pruned stubs close to their cut line to prevent moisture buildup and pest harborage.
  • Inspect for any clean, smooth cuts and ensure no torn bark or torn cambium remains. If you see major bark ripping or large wood damage, note it for professional assessment.
  • Protect young, exposed trunks from sunscald by providing a light, temporary shade if the trunk will be exposed to harsh afternoon sun for several weeks.
  • Keep children and pets away from fresh wounds until healing begins and hazards are clear.

Watering Guidelines for Local Conditions

  • Newly pruned or recently planted trees need deeper, slower irrigation to promote strong root growth. Water deeply to reach 12–18 inches in the root zone, then allow the soil to dry slightly before the next soak.
  • In hot, dry summers, established trees benefit from deep, infrequent watering rather than frequent shallow watering. Aim for moisture penetration rather than surface wetting.
  • For clay soils common in Turlock yards, monitor drainage; overwatering can lead to root rot. For sandy soils, water more slowly and more often to prevent rapid drying.
  • Use drip irrigation or soaker hoses to minimize foliage wetting, reduce disease pressure, and conserve water during drought restrictions.
  • In winter, rely on rainfall when available; supplement only as needed to keep the root zone moist but not waterlogged.

Mulching and Soil Health

  • Apply 2–4 inches of mulch in a circular ring extending to the drip line, keeping at least 6 inches clear of the trunk to avoid trunk rot.
  • Use shredded bark, wood chips, or well-composted mulch. Avoid fresh, chunky organics that can tie up nitrogen as they decay.
  • Mulch conserves soil moisture, moderates soil temperature, and reduces weed competition. In Turlock’s clay soils, mulch also helps improve soil structure over time.
  • Periodically test soil if you notice persistent nutrient deficiencies or poor growth. Local resources like the Stanislaus County Soil Conservation District or UC Cooperative Extension can guide soil tests and interpretation.
  • Fertilize only if a deficiency is identified. In drought-prone periods, oversupply of fertilizer can stress roots and provoke disease.

Monitoring for Stress, Pests, and Disease

  • Do a simple quarterly check: look for wilting, leaf scorch, chlorosis, leaf drop out of season, or unusual branch dieback.
  • Watch for pests such as scale insects, aphids, borers, and spider mites. Stressed trees are more susceptible, and signs can appear on new growth first.
  • Look for cankers, cracking bark, oozing, or discolored cambium. Early detection improves treatment outcomes.
  • When in doubt, contact a certified arborist. Local ISA- and CA-licensed professionals can confirm diagnosis and advise on targeted interventions.
  • Weather-driven stress patterns in Turlock—hot, dry spells followed by cool, wet periods—can create episodic pest outbreaks. An annual inspection helps keep problems from becoming long-term issues.

Long-Term Pruning and Maintenance Schedule

  • Establish a regular pruning cadence based on species and growth rate. Most deciduous shade trees benefit from major structural pruning every 3–5 years; light annual adjustments help retain form.
  • Remove dead, damaged, or crossing limbs annually to maintain airflow and reduce disease risk.
  • Schedule major structural pruning during a tree’s dormant period to minimize stress; avoid heavy pruning during peak heat in summer.
  • After pruning, re-evaluate water and mulch needs. Adjust irrigation zones and mulch depth as the tree size and site conditions change.

Stump Management and Site Restoration

  • If a stump remains after removal, grinding is the quickest route to restoration. Plan to remove residual roots within a comfortable radius to prevent new sprouts.
  • After grinding, backfill with quality topsoil and reseed or plant groundcovers that tolerate the site’s sun exposure and root competition.
  • Keep the area free of trips or equipment hazards until the site stabilizes.

Replanting Recommendations for Turlock

  • When selecting replacements, prioritize drought-tolerant, California-adapted species that suit local microclimates (hot summers, cool winters, and irrigation restrictions).
  • Favor trees with upright growth for restricted spaces, strong root systems, and resistance to local pests. Consider native options such as Ceanothus (California lilac), Madrone relatives, Manzanita, and drought-tolerant oaks where appropriate.
  • Avoid incompatible pairings (e.g., water-intensive species in areas with restricted irrigation or trees known to be fragile in heat). Check root-zone and mature-size requirements to prevent future conflicts with sidewalks, driveways, or foundations.
  • Plan for existing yard conditions: shaded lots beneath tall evergreens may require more mulch and soil amendments to support root health; waterfront-adjacent or slope areas may benefit from erosion control and windbreak planting.

Common mistakes to avoid

  • Volcano mulching (piling mulch against the trunk) and thick mulches near stems.
  • Overwatering after pruning or planting, especially in clay soils.
  • Planting incompatible species that demand more water or maintenance than the site can provide.
